## Session Handling for Health Checks

The Corvel gateway sits behind the Lanternside load balancer, which probes /healthz every ten seconds. Health-check requests are stateless by design: they bypass the session store entirely so that probe traffic never inflates session counts or evicts real user sessions. New team members should note that the deep-check endpoint, /healthz/deep, does verify session-store connectivity and therefore requires authentication. When probing it manually, supply the token below.

bearer token for tajep-kajef: eyJhbGciOiJIUzI1NiIsInR5cCI6IkpXVCJ9.eyJzdWIiOiIoOsZ23In0.CsygO0hs

FINANCE REVIEW SUMMARY — Q3 Capacity Decision, Maribel Works

For sales leads: the review confirmed the Maribel Works line can absorb a 14% volume increase without capital spend, but anything beyond that requires the second extrusion line, estimated at eight months to commission. Margin impact of deferring is modest this year and grows sharply next. Quote lead times accordingly and avoid committing to volumes above the current ceiling. The rationale behind the board's preferred option is summarised in the confidential note below.

board note of kageg-bahof: The renewal with Holwynax Holdings closes at $2 million a year, 5 percent below the last contract. Project Ulaath slips by two quarters because of the supplier delay.

## Authentication

Heads up for reviewers: the Pairlight matching service runs on a JVM, and long GC pauses can delay token validation, occasionally making auth look flaky when it isn't. We've tuned pause targets to 50ms, but spikes still happen under rebalance. Don't treat isolated 401-then-200 patterns as a security signal. To exercise the auth path yourself against staging, send requests with the bearer token below.

session JWT of yawep-yawep = eyJhbGciOiJIUzI1NiIsInR5cCI6IkpXVCJ9.eyJzdWIiOiI3pWF3_In0.aXYsHiog